This easy to make Buffalo Chicken Chili combines all the classic flavors– hot sauce, celery and blue cheese. It freezes well and is great for a quick weeknight meal!

Buffalo Chicken Chili
 
Print
Recipe type: Entree
Serves: 4
Ingredients
  • 1 lb ground chicken
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 onion, diced
  • 2 stalks celery, sliced
  • 1 large carrot,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up beer or chicken broth
  • 1 (15 oz) can diced tomatoes
  • 1 (15 oz) can cannellini be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 tsp cumin
  • 1 tsp paprika
  • ½ tsp oregano
  • ¼ tsp cayenne
  • ½ cup hot sauce (I used Frank’s RedHot)
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Crumbled blue cheese, for serving
Instructions
  1. Cook the chicken in a dutch oven or large pot over medium heat. Remove from pot and set aside.
  2. Heat the oil in the dutch oven and, add the onions, celery and carrots. Cook until tender, about 10-15 minutes.
  3. Add the garlic and cook until fragrant, about a minute.
  4. Add the beer or broth to deglaze the pan, then add the cooked chicken, tomatoes, beans, cumin, paprika, oregano, cayenne and hot sauce and simmer for 15 minutes.
  5. Serve topped with crumbled blue cheese.
